Synopsis
Forty-year-old Li Qiuer calls himself a "middle-aged loser" who likes art and philosophy. He lives a tense but ordinary life in Beijing by writing scattered manuscripts and collecting art. His wife, Yu Xi, is a college design teacher with an orderly life. In his eyes, this twenty-year relationship was frank and transparent - until that summer, when he accompanied his wife to teach in a small town called "Shasi". Shasi Town seems to have been forgotten by time, and the streets remain in the 1980s and 1990s: faded Hong Kong-style signboards, empty video halls, and old-fashioned street lamps that are always half-lit. While taking a walk in the evening, Yu Xi suddenly said in an understatement: "Actually, I have 27 million." This sentence was like a bullet, shattering Li Qiuer's entire understanding of marriage and self. He was surprised and confused, thinking it was just concealment and betrayal, but he didn't know that this was just the beginning of another world. That night, Yu Xi took him to the terrace of the dilapidated building in the west of the town - a secret gathering place disguised as a "rustic nightclub". The neon light passed by, and she walked past him wearing an extremely unfamiliar, sexy and cold dance outfit. Then, a sudden massacre broke out on the terrace: the crowd drew guns and killed each other, and blood splashed on the lights. Yu Xi showed a completely different side in the chaos: two guns in hand, calm and ruthless skills, and careful ear protection all the way. With Shasi Town completely out of control, bus drivers, clinic doctors, stall couples, hotel receptionists, elementary school physical education teachers... Seemingly ordinary townspeople reveal their true identities one after another - they are all top killers lurking here, each representing different forces, and they revolve around a hidden gambling game: the selection of successors secretly initiated by the "world's largest mercenary organization". Only then did Li Qiuer learn that his father, who "died" five years ago, had not really left the world. He was the mastermind behind this bloody game; and Yu Xi was a top killer who had been trained since he was a teenager and was sent to protect him. Every street, every corner, and every "chance encounter" in Shasi Town is as unpredictable as the 19-way Go game. After layers of truth were revealed, Li Qiuer was forced to make a choice between "his father's world", "the truth about his wife" and "living as an ordinary person": he was both the bait and the bargaining chip, and the executor of the final decision. After the town was washed by blood and fire, Li Qiu'er walked towards an unknown Taoist temple in the grief of losing his relatives - there, he would close his last door and let "Li Qiu'er" disappear forever in that summer in Shasi.
